E'. 'McGRAN'N. Tea Kettle. No. 66.607. Patented July 9., 1867.
guitar giant gamut @ffirs.
EDWARD MCGRANN, OF LOUISVILLR K'ENTUCKY.
Letters Patent No. 66,607, dated July 9, 1867 TEA-KEITTLE.
TO WHOM IT MAY CONCERN:
Be it known that I, EDWARD MGGRANN, of Louisville, Jefferson county, Kentucky, have invented a, new and useful Tea-Kettle; and I do hereby declare the following to be a full, clear, and exact description of the some, referencebeing had to the accompanying drawings, making part of this specification.
This is an improvement on the class of tea-kettles whose lid being attached by a vertical pivot opens and closes horizontally; end'my invention consists in a form and construction of the connecting-pivot and its accessories, which combine the adveutziges of cheapness and simplicity with effectiveness.
A is the kettle body and B is the lid. C is an orifice in the rim of the body, near to but preferably to one side of the rear hail-ear. D is a boss or elevated margin to said orifice. E is a doubly countersunk orifice in f the lid, Whose lower portion, 2', fits/and is adapted to swing around the boss D. F is the pivot, provided with a conical head, f, which fits and rests upon the top of the boss 1) so as to relieve the upper countersink e from binding and to permit the unrestricted swing of the lid. The lower endf of the pivot is screw-threaded, and enters a nut, G, which, occupying a recess, a, in the body that prevents its rotation, is screwed fast against the under side of the body-rim by the application of a customary driver in the nickf.
I claim herein as new, and of my invention:-
The swinging lid B, having the doubly countersunk orifice E e e, in the described combination with the bossed orifice C D, conical-headed and screw-threaded pivot Ffff, and nut G, the whole being combined and arranged as set forth. 7
